The invention relates to a new energy wireless charging facility for a photovoltaic corridor. Clean energy generated by the structure of the photovoltaic corridor is used as energy for a new energy electric vehicle. The system adopts radio interconnection to charge the new energy electric vehicle while the new energy electric vehicle runs, and solves the energy problem caused by mileage anxiety of long-distance running of the new energy electric vehicle and difficulty in charging. And the new energy electric vehicle running on the road can be charged while running, so that the convenience of energy supply is ensured.
